Description


You can bypass the Klamml using the following route (which does not feature any exposed sections):

You will come to path 824 from the Bergsteigergrab, turning onto path 812a above the Gaudeamushütte mountain hut as you head south towards the Wochenbrunner Alm via Gamswegl. Follow this trail through the forest, then through a field of scree. Back in the forest, you then head to the intersection with path 825. You should then follow this path north to the Gruttenhütte mountain hut. This path largely leads through a thin forest up to the tree line. Across a gravel cirque and partly rocky terrain you will first reach the Gruttenkopf and then the Gruttenhütte (1,620 m), the highest refuge in the Wilder Kaiser.
